Meaning & origin

Daysi is a modern respelling of Daisy, a name drawn from the English flower name. The name Daisy entered common use in the 19th century, but the variant Daysi first appeared in U.S. records in 1970. Daysi reached its peak popularity in 1996, when it ranked highest in usage; since then its frequency has been steadily falling. As of 2025, the name ranks 4,265th and occurs in roughly 1 in 48,705 births, making it an uncommon choice. The spelling Daysi is most popular in Texas, which ranks as its top state. While the original Daisy remains a classic, Daysi offers a streamlined, phonetic twist on a floral favorite.

Daysi is a spelling variant of Daisy, which derives from the Old English 'dæges eage' meaning 'day's eye', referring to the flower that opens at dawn. The given name Daisy has been used since the 19th century, and Daysi is a modern respelling.

Questions parents ask

What is the meaning of the name Daysi?
Daysi is a variant spelling of Daisy, derived from the flower name, which itself comes from Old English 'dæges eage' meaning 'day's eye'.
How popular is the name Daysi currently?
In 2025, Daysi ranked 4,265th in the United States, with about 1 in every 48,705 newborn girls given the name.
Is Daysi a boy or girl name?
Daysi is almost exclusively used as a girl's name.
